2003 Honda Accord vs. 1961 Tatra T603

To start off, 2003 Honda Accord is newer by 42 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1961 Tatra T603.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1961 Tatra T603 would be higher. At 2,545 cc (8 cylinders), 1961 Tatra T603 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2003 Honda Accord (138 HP @ 4000 RPM) has 44 more horse power than 1961 Tatra T603. (94 HP @ 5000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2003 Honda Accord should accelerate faster than 1961 Tatra T603.

Because 1961 Tatra T603 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1961 Tatra T603.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2003 Honda Accord,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2003 Honda Accord (340 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 181 more torque (in Nm) than 1961 Tatra T603. (159 Nm @ 3000 RPM). This means 2003 Honda Accord will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1961 Tatra T603.
